The Web Is Being Read, Not Just Indexed

Traditional search engines send crawlers to index pages and return links. You rank by earning clicks, backlinks, domain authority, and paid placement. The game is about getting to page one.

AI works differently. It reads and synthesizes. When someone asks an AI about local businesses, it draws from everything it has ingested: reviews, forum posts, community discussions, directories, structured data, and platform signals. It is not returning links. It is constructing a picture of your business from everything it can find about you.

If AI can find strong, consistent, legitimate signals about what your business does and who it serves, you appear in the answer. If it can’t, you don’t.

This is why the ad-auction era is ending. You cannot buy placement in an AI synthesis. You can only earn it.
